Minecraft | Qui aurait cru que le célèbre jeu de construction en blocs pourrait un jour rencontrer COBOL, un langage de programmation vieux de plus de 60 ans ? C’est pourtant le pari fou relevé par un développeur passionné, qui a réussi à créer un serveur Minecraft entièrement codé en COBOL. Cette fusion inattendue entre ancien et nouveau ouvre des perspectives fascinantes pour l’avenir du développement de jeux.
Un mariage improbable entre Minecraft et COBOL
Imaginez un instant : vous lancez votre partie de Minecraft favorite, et derrière les coulisses, c’est COBOL qui fait tourner la boutique ! Cette idée un peu folle est devenue réalité grâce au projet CobolCraft, un serveur Minecraft entièrement développé dans ce langage réputé austère. Le créateur de ce projet hors-norme, un certain Meyfa, n’avait pourtant aucune expérience préalable en COBOL. Comme quoi, avec de la motivation, on peut vraiment faire des miracles !
Bien sûr, fusionner Minecraft et COBOL n’a pas été une mince affaire. COBOL n’est pas vraiment conçu pour manipuler des bits et des octets comme l’exige le protocole de Minecraft. Mais avec un peu d’ingéniosité et beaucoup de persévérance, Meyfa a réussi à surmonter ces obstacles techniques. Le résultat ? Un serveur Minecraft fonctionnel, avec quelques limitations mineures, mais globalement très performant.
Pourquoi associer Minecraft et COBOL ?
On peut se demander quel intérêt il y a à développer un serveur Minecraft en COBOL. Après tout, Java est déjà parfaitement adapté à cette tâche. Mais c’est justement là que réside tout l’intérêt de ce projet : montrer que COBOL, malgré son âge vénérable, reste un langage capable de relever des défis modernes.
Cette fusion inattendue entre Minecraft et COBOL pourrait bien avoir des retombées intéressantes. D’une part, elle pourrait susciter un regain d’intérêt pour COBOL auprès des jeunes développeurs. D’autre part, elle pourrait inspirer d’autres projets audacieux mêlant jeux vidéo et langages de programmation anciens.
Un projet qui ouvre de nouvelles perspectives
Le succès de CobolCraft nous rappelle qu’en matière de programmation, l’imagination est la seule limite. Qui sait, peut-être verrons-nous bientôt d’autres jeux populaires portés vers des langages inattendus ? Imaginez un instant Fortnite en FORTRAN ou GTA 6 en assembleur !
Plus sérieusement, ce projet montre que les frontières entre les différents domaines de l’informatique sont de plus en plus floues. Les jeux vidéo peuvent servir de terrain d’expérimentation pour des technologies anciennes, tandis que ces dernières peuvent apporter leur robustesse à des applications modernes.
Un pont entre deux mondes
Au final, CobolCraft est bien plus qu’une simple curiosité technique. C’est un pont jeté entre deux mondes : celui des jeux vidéo modernes, incarné par Minecraft, et celui de l’informatique d’entreprise traditionnelle, représenté par COBOL. Cette fusion inattendue nous rappelle que l’innovation naît souvent de la rencontre improbable entre des univers a priori éloignés.
Alors, prêts à tenter l’aventure Minecraft en COBOL ? Qui sait, vous découvrirez peut-être une nouvelle passion pour ce langage historique. Et si jamais vous préférez rester dans des eaux plus familières, sachez que Fortnite accueille de nouveau Master Chief, une fusion un peu moins inattendue mais tout aussi excitante !